Title:   BYZANTINE BROWN-GLAZED JUGLET
Category Code:   C
Year:   1935
Object Number:   5
Description:   Juglet with flat bottom, ovoid body with max diam. below median, tapering to narrow neck with flaring profile to squared lip (in so far preserved). Vertical strap handle attached to neck and lip, and body above max diam. Similar to C-1934-337 (Morgan 1942, Corinth 11, cat. 52).
Decoration:   Brown glaze on exterior above max diam., paches of glaze on lower body and bottom. Single grooved line above max diam.
Material:   Red clay with frequent small to large subrounded tabular and spherical white and few small gray inclusions. Few angular tabular and rounded spherical voids.
Munsell Color:   10R 5/8 (red)
Condition:   Complete profile. Two joining frgts., preserving nearly complete vessel; missing 1/2 rim.
Period:   Middle Byzantine (802-1058 AD)
Chronology:   11th c. CE, based on comparanda
